I. The Rise of Smartcubing as a Global Phenomenon
Smartcubing involves solving the iconic Magic Cubes with remarkable speed and precision with the help of contemporary technologies.
To truly understand the smartcubing revolution, we must first take a journey back in time, to the creation of the magic cube itself. Invented in the early 1970s by Hungarian sculptor and professor Ernő Rubik, this deceptively simple-looking puzzle would lay the foundation for an international craze.
Magic Cube, also known as Rubik's Cube, made its public debut in Budapest in 1974. Its six colorful faces, each made up of nine smaller squares, immediately captured the imagination of those who dared to twist and turn its perplexing design.
As magic cubes gained popularity, a competitive spirit emerged among cubers. People competed to solve the cube in the least time and steps. This marked the birth of speedcubing, a subculture that aimed to solve the cube in the shortest time possible. Timers, algorithms, and strategies began to take center stage.
With the help of modern technologies like electronic timers and algorithms, plus the internet that connects cubers around the globe to communicate and compete with each other, speedcubing has quickly developed into smartcubing, namely cubing with the help of smart technologies.
II. What Is Smartcubing?
At its core, smartcubing is a sport that utilizes smart technologies like digital timers, internet battlefields, and most importantly intelligent solving coaches and step counters. However, in its essence, it also demands precision, pattern recognition, and unparalleled hand-eye coordination. It's the art of solving the magic cubes at astonishing speeds, often measured in seconds.
While traditional cubing involves casual solving for fun or relaxation, smartcubing is a high-stakes, adrenaline-pumping competition that draws participants from all walks of life.
In the modern era, technology has played a pivotal role in smartcubing's growth. Specialized cubes, timers, and smartphone apps have ushered in an era of unparalleled cube-solving precision.

IV. Smartcubing Equipment
Smartcubing is developed with the rapid development of equipment from innovative brands like GAN Cubes. There are many gears that make this game a competition.
One of the examples is smart timers. Accuracy is the name of the game in smartcubing, and specialized timers and smartphone apps ensure that every fraction of a second counts in competitions.
Meanwhile, cubers often customize their cubes with specific modifications to suit their preferences. These modifications range from adjusting tension to lubing the cube for smoother, faster solves.

VI. Training and Techniques of Smartcubing
To win in smartcubing competitions, speedcubers employ various cube-solving methods, each with its own algorithms and strategies, honing their skills through endless practice and refinement.
Finger agility is a critical component of smartcubing's success. Just like other sports, cubers develop lightning-fast finger movements through rigorous training, enabling them to execute algorithms with breathtaking speed.
As Feliks Zemdegs said in his 2021 interview withthe Guardian, "The key is patience and practice".
That said, smartcubing isn't just about solving quickly; it's also about memorizing complex algorithms, a skill that requires intense focus and dedication. Professional cubers also spend a lot of time remembering algorithms with the help of smart apps.
